2. Key Documents Required
To make an application for a Polish chauffeur's license, people must submit numerous crucial documents. This can vary slightly depending on whether the candidate is a Polish resident or a foreign nationwide.
For Polish Citizens:Personal Identification: A legitimate Polish ID card (dowód osobisty).Health Certificate: A document verifying the candidate's physical fitness to drive, issued by a medical physician.Mental Assessment: Required for particular categories, particularly for industrial driving.Evidence of Residence: A document proving habitual house in Poland (e.g., energy expense).Application Form: Completed application for a chauffeur's license.For Foreign Nationals:Valid Passport: A present passport is necessary.House Permit: Proof of legal status in Poland (e.g., momentary residency card).Translation of Documents: If any documents are not in Polish, they must be translated officially.Health Certificate: Similar to Polish residents; a medical check-up is compulsory.Driving School Certificate: Proof of completion from an accredited driving school may be needed.3. Driving Tests in Poland
Driving tests in Poland are divided into theory and useful elements:

Theory Test: This test covers traffic laws, road signs, and safe driving practices. It is primarily multiple-choice and computerized.

Practical Test: Exam prospects need to demonstrate their driving skills in real traffic. This includes maneuvers such as parking, combining, and complying with traffic signals.

Prospects must prepare thoroughly, as stopping working either part of the exam indicates a wait period before reapplying.
5. Distinguishing Between Foreign and Polish Licenses
Foreign citizens living in Poland might already possess a driver's license provided in another nation. Here matter indicate think about:
Recognition of Foreign Licenses: Many foreign licenses are valid in Poland for a restricted time, generally up to 6 months for travelers or expatriates.Conversion: Foreign nationals can exchange their current motorist's licenses for a Polish one, offered they fulfill particular conditions (e.g., valid residency status).Assessment Requirements: Some applicants may require to take the theory or practical test again, depending on the initial license's releasing nation.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
